...I stayed at this hotel during my third trip to Hawaii in 2006. The big plus point to this hotel is the location combined with the value. The hotel is just a very short walk from Waikiki Beach, the shops, restaurants & the beachfront hotels. It has a central location which takes you right into the heart of Waikiki but being on Kuhio Avenue it has great access to The Bus for anyone wanting to explore the island. The hotel also has a recommended Thai restaurant (Keo's) on the ground floor which also does a breakfast menu. There are other options nearby. The hotel itself does not have a real breakfast area.
The hotel facilities are good for people using it as base. It has an Outrigger Activities centre to help organise events, a small shop and helpful hotel staff. The condition of the hotel is good also. Our room was large enough...

...We stayed at the Ohana Maile Sky Court Hotel in Honolulu for 4 nights in September 2005 at the end of a three week holiday to the Hawaiian islands.
The hotel has a large, airy reception area and lobby with plenty of comfortable seating. The staff were helpful, friendly and accomodating. We arrived about an hour before check-in time and they re-arranged the bookings so that we could have a room that was already available immediately. My 2-year old daughter was also very happy to be given a free beach ball by one of the check-in staff!
Our room was on one of the highest floors and the view was spectacular - it felt as if you had just taken off in a plane! We could see the ocean and diamond head in the distance. The room itself - a standard size double was, however, a little on the small size, especially with a camp bed for our 2-year old...
